﻿.portfolio
{
    background-color: #FFFFFF;
    width: 700px;
    font-family: "Trebuchet MS",Arial,Sans-Serif;
}

.SlideShow
{
    margin: 0 0 0 20px;
    padding: 0;
}

.SlideShow .AspNet-FormView
{
}

/* HeaderText or <HeaderTemplate> */
.SlideShow .AspNet-FormView-Header
{
    margin: 0 0 10px 0;
    font-weight: bold;
    font-size: larger;
}

/* Controls the appearance of whatever you define in the <ItemTemplate> */
.SlideShow .AspNet-FormView-Data
{
}

/* Controls the appearance of whatever you define in the pagination region. */
.SlideShow .AspNet-FormView-Pagination
{
    margin-bottom: 10px;
}

/* This controls the appearance of the "current page" listed in the pagination region. */
/* This is NOT a link */
.SlideShow .AspNet-FormView-ActivePage
{
    color: White;
    background-color: #999999;
}

/* Controls the numbers used to navigate to other pages. */
/* This is a link */
.SlideShow .AspNet-FormView-OtherPage,
.SlideShow .AspNet-FormView-ActivePage
{
    margin-left: 4px;
    padding: 0 1px 0 1px;
}

.SlideShow a.AspNet-FormView-OtherPage:hover
{
}

.SlideShow .ProjectName
{
    font-size: 16px;
    font-weight: bold;
    display: block;
    margin-bottom: 1em;
}

.SlideShow .ProjectThumbnail
{
    width: 250px;
    float: left;
}

.SlideShow .ProjectDescription
{
    float: left;
    width: 400px;
    height: 200px;
}

.ProofSheet
{
    padding: 10px;
}

.ProofSheet .AspNet-DataList table caption
{
    display: none; /* not being shown for the moment */    
}

.ProofSheet .AspNet-DataList table tbody tr
{
    padding-top: 20px;
    padding-bottom: 20px;
}

.ProofSheet .AspNet-DataList table tbody tr td
{
    vertical-align: top;
    padding: 0 20px 20px 30px;
}

.ProofSheet .ProjectName
{
    display:block;
    text-align: center;
    font-size:larger;
}

.ProofSheet .ProjectThumbnail
{
    display:block;
    text-align: center;    
}

.ProofSheet .ProjectDescription ul
{
    margin-top: 0;
}

.ProofSheet .ProjectDescription ul li
{
    list-style-type: circle;
}

.ViewMode
{
    display:block;
    text-align: right;
    margin-right: 30px;
}

.portfolio .automate
{
    margin: 0;
    padding: 0 0 0 20px;
    color: #666666;
}


/**************************************/
/* for new portfolio page */
.portfolio h1
{
    margin-left: 10px;
}
.portfolio .l-client p,
.portfolio .r-client p
{
    margin: 0 10px 2px 0;
}

.portfolio .l-client
{
    clear: both;
    float: left;
    width: 330px;
    padding-left: 10px;
}
.portfolio .l-client h2
{
    font-size: 1em;
    margin-top: 15px;
    margin-bottom: 0;
}
.portfolio .l-client img
{
    float: right;
    width: 200px;
    margin-top: 15px;
    margin-left: 5px; 
    margin-right: 5px;
}

.portfolio .r-client h2
{
    font-size: 1em;
    margin-top: 15px;
    margin-bottom: 0;
    padding-left: 10px;
}
.portfolio .r-client img
{
    float: left;
    width: 200px;
    margin-top: 15px;
    margin-left: 5px;
    margin-right: 10px;
}


